Effects of Pentoxifylline on the healing of irradiated wounds in pig skin
M. Rezvani , G.A. Ross , K. Lamb , J. H. Wilkinson
Abstract:   (18984 Views)

Background: This study was designed to investigate the efficacy of Pentoxifylline (PTX) in the treatment of irradiated wounds.

Materials and Methods: Ten female pigs of the Large White strain were used in these
investigations. Six skin fields, 4 * 4 cm and separated from each other by 4 cm, were marked out on each flank and those on left flank were irradiated with 18Gy single dose of 250 kV X-rays. The animals were then randomly allocated to one of three groups. Ten weeks after irradiation a 2 * 2 cm surgical wound was produced, by removing the skin up to facia level, at the centre of the original skin fields. This was done on both irradiated (left flank) and unirradiated control (right flank) fields. Two groups of animals were treated by daily oral gavaging, with 13.3mg/kg/day PTX dissolved in 10 ml water while a group of control animals received only 10 ml water by oral gavage as placebo. PTX treatment started either two weeks prior to wounding or at the day of wounding. The progression of the healing of excision wounds were evaluated periodically by assessment of wound contraction.

Results and Conclusion: Overall, irradiated wounds healed much slower than unirradiated wounds. While PTX treatment had no effect on the healing rate of unirradiated wounds it appeared that treating the animals with PTX delayed the healing of irradiated wounds. This was true whether PTX treatment started two weeks prior to or at the time of wounding. Iran . J. Radiat. Res., 2004 2 (1): 1-7
